Understanding Lithium Fluorocarbon Batteries

Lithium Fluorocarbon batteries, also known as Li/CFx batteries, are a type of lithium battery that uses fluorocarbon as the cathode material. They are known for their high energy density, long shelf life, and reliability. These characteristics make them suitable for a wide range of applications, from medical devices and industrial equipment to aerospace and defense systems.
